High Performance Coaching & Feedback

High Performance Coaching & Feedback addresses a key organizational challenge many businesses and nonprofits face. How to best prepare managers so they can effectively lead their team and produce strong results for the organization while handling the stress of their new role. The program is best suited for your emerging leaders who are either in their first formal management role, have a role such as team leader that requres them to coach others and provide feedback, or are seen as potential managers.

High Performance Coaching & Feedback uses a proven learning process that combines role-plays, instructor-led discussion and lecture on best practices. The result is your managers will leave the session better prepared to lead their teams and handle new challenges. The instructor follows up with each participant regularly to discuss progress.

Objectives include:

-Identify the psychological obstacles that prevent new managers and emerging leaders from delivering candid feedback, providing frequent praise and initiating coversations about performance issues.
-Develop effective coaching and feedback skills.
-Create a process so their feedback and praise is consistent and concise.
-Understand the differences between formal performance reviews and informal, consistent feedack.
-Practice real-world situations through role-plays so participants return to the office prepared to immediately begin implementing what they learned.
